John Hinshelwood's Match Report

Return to Report Main Page
Maryhill  v. Shotts
0 -
2

15th August 2009
 

 

A disappointing performance saw Maryhill lose the opening match of their league campaign.
 
The visitors opened strongly, and went ahead after only three minutes. Paul McLaughlin beat several Maryhill defenders before sending a well placed shot past Mark Wilson. Despite this setback, the home side hit back and the trialist striker blasted over from close range. They forced a succession of corners, and four headed efforts from John Cunningham came close, three going wide and one striking the post. Ryan Scobie then  had a long range shot well held by Craig Brown in the Shotts goal, before the trialist stiker passed up a great opportunity to equalise for Hill. Craig Ferguson's inch perfect pass saw the striker beat the offside trap, but he finished weakly with only the keeper to beat. Shotts, who had always looked dangerous on the break ,got a second goal seven minutes from the interval when John Boyack shot home from close range, after a couple of attempts had been blocked. Maryhill were perhaps somewhat unfortunate to be behind at the break, but they failed to cash in on their outfield dominance, whereas the visitors took the chances that presented themselves.
 
Half Time - Maryhill 0  Shotts 2
 
The second half was pretty much a non event, almost devoid of incident. Maryhill did not create a single goal scoring opportunity, and for the visitors a disallowed "goal", and a William Russell shot which crashed off the underside of the bar were the only real incidents of note. Fourteen minutes from the end, a bad day for Maryhill got worse when Mark Stanley was sent off for an off the ball incident. The game then petered out, with the visitors probably deserving the three points.
